The SEC's Case Against Ripple and its Implications for XRP
The Core Arguments of the SEC's Lawsuit
The SEC alleges that Ripple conducted an unregistered securities offering through the sale of XRP. Their central claim rests on the assertion that XRP sales constituted investment contracts, meeting the criteria of the Howey Test. This test defines an investment contract as an investment of money in a common enterprise with the expectation of profits primarily derived from the efforts of others. The SEC argues that Ripple's efforts to promote and develop XRP, along with the expectation of increased value by investors, satisfy this definition. They point to Ripple's sales of XRP to institutional investors and the general public as evidence of an unregistered securities offering, violating federal securities laws.
Ripple's Defense and Counterarguments
Ripple vehemently denies the SEC's claims, arguing that XRP is a decentralized digital currency, not a security. Their defense rests on several key points:
- Decentralization: Ripple contends that XRP operates independently of Ripple Labs, with its value determined by market forces rather than Ripple's actions.
- Programmatic Issuance: Ripple highlights that XRP's issuance is automated, programmed into its blockchain, differing from traditional securities offerings controlled by a central entity.
- Functionality as a Currency: They emphasize XRP's use in cross-border payments and its utility within the broader cryptocurrency ecosystem, arguing that it functions primarily as a medium of exchange, not an investment contract.
The Impact of the Lawsuit on XRP's Price and Trading Volume
The Ripple vs. SEC lawsuit has significantly impacted XRP's price and trading volume. Initial news of the lawsuit led to a sharp drop in XRP's price. Subsequent court developments have caused further volatility, with price fluctuations directly correlated to positive or negative news related to the case. Trading volume on major exchanges has also experienced periods of increased and decreased activity, reflecting the fluctuating investor sentiment and regulatory uncertainty surrounding XRP. This uncertainty has significantly eroded investor confidence, creating a volatile and unpredictable market for XRP.
Potential Outcomes of the SEC Lawsuit and Their Effects on XRP
Scenario 1: SEC Victory – XRP Deemed a Security
If the SEC prevails, XRP would likely be classified as an unregistered security. This could have several severe consequences:
- Delisting from Exchanges: Major cryptocurrency exchanges might delist XRP, limiting access to trading for many investors.
- Price Collapse: A security classification could lead to a significant drop in XRP's price, potentially rendering many investments worthless.
- Legal Ramifications for Ripple and Investors: Ripple could face substantial fines and penalties, and investors could face legal repercussions for participating in what the SEC deemed an illegal securities offering.
Scenario 2: Ripple Victory – XRP Deemed Not a Security
A Ripple victory would have profoundly positive consequences:
- Price Surge: Regulatory clarity confirming XRP's status as a non-security would likely trigger a significant price increase.
- Increased Adoption: Greater regulatory certainty could boost investor confidence and lead to wider adoption by financial institutions and businesses.
- Enhanced Market Capitalization: The removal of regulatory uncertainty would likely result in increased market capitalization for XRP.
Scenario 3: A Negotiated Settlement
A negotiated settlement between Ripple and the SEC remains a possibility. This could involve various outcomes, such as:
- Partial Security Classification: A compromise might classify certain XRP sales as securities while others are not.
- Compliance Agreements: Ripple might agree to specific compliance measures to avoid further legal action.
- Future Regulatory Framework: A settlement might indirectly influence the future regulatory landscape for cryptocurrencies.
